Welcome to the Hive!
We are the Queen Bee youth project based in Leicestershire. Winners of the Hinckley and Bosworth Council - Making a difference in the community award 2019. Who are we? By day Zoe is an OFSTED registered (rated outstanding, obviously) child minder and Jo is a marketing & finance manager & youth worker - both living in Markfield. Jo has a higher distinction in youth work and adolescent depression at level 3. Two strong mothers with a passion to keep our beautiful young ladies off the streets, off their phones and making healthy lifestyle choices. We aim to gear them with the confidence and knowledge to thrive in this crazy world!
We focus on physical and mental well being, life skills, staying active, helping in the community and having lots of fun! With an array of experience and qualifications from psychology, mental health, accounting, management, childminding, youth work, basic army training, classical music and more we are a fountain of useful knowledge and we’re ready to share it with your busy bees! When do we run? Thursday evenings, 7pm - 8:30pm Markfield Sports and Community Centre, Mayflower Close, LE67 9ST (Full) How much? £4 per session - this covers activities, insurance and venue hire
How do we join? Pop us a Facebook message with your child’s name and date of birth. We’ll put them on the list for a space & send you the necessary paperwork to enrol. There is a £12 member fee which includes the Queen Bee t-shirt.
